WebAug 14, 2014 · Accredited Investor Definition To qualify as an accredited investor, a purchaser must be one of the specified persons or entities set forth in Securities Act Rule 501 (a). Purchasers that are natural persons typically qualify under the net worth test or the annual income test. WebAug 28, 2024 · Entities that have long been excluded from the accredited investor definition – including Indian tribes, governmental bodies and funds, and entities organized under the laws of foreign countries – may now qualify under a new category which permits any entity owning “investments,” as defined in Rule 2a51-1(b) under the Investment …
